Paying a Probate Lawyer: Costs & Types of Fees AllLaw
Webb4% of the first 100,000 of the gross value of the probate estate. 3% of the next $100,000. 2% of the next $800,000. 1% of the next $9 million. ½% of the next 15 million. "a reasonable amount" of anything over $25 million. Using this system, probating a typical California estate with a gross value of $500,000 would cost $13,000 in legal fees ... The statutory fee in Ohio is 4% of the first $100,000, 3% of the next $300,000, and 2% of probate assets over $400,000. Webb10 jan. 2011 · Attorney fees charged for handling matters of the estate must, in most cases, be approved by the court and typically are based on a flat fee, percentage or hourly rate as agreed by the executor and beneficiaries. The executor or administrator is paid a fee set by Ohio law based on a percentage of the value of the estate assets administered. Webbattorney fees (these fees can be negotiated between the executor and the lawyer; some counties also publish fee schedules, but these are not mandatory) appraisal fees (when necessary to determine the value of estate assets).
